What is design to you?
Design, in my opinion, is a happy dance between form and function in which each tiny element works together to create and tell a story. As an interior designer, I view design as an opportunity to connect with people through spaces.
It all comes down to understanding how one would live, work and play in their spaces to then creating meaningful solutions that makes their lives better while reflecting their unique personality. To design is to create something vibrant, functional, and soulful, where purpose and imagination meet.
